GEORGE ARMSTRONG CUSTER, C. 1864
CUSTER, George Armstrong (1839-1876). Photograph signed ("With Compliments of G. A. Custer") on verso, n.p., n.d [2 July-30 August 1874, but later].
Mounted albumen photograph, 192 x 155mm (light surface scratches, one small dent near bear's head, mounting remnants on top edge of verso).

Lot Essay

A buckskin-clad Custer on a hunting outing during the 1874 Black Hills Expedition.

The image was captured by William H. Illingworth, the expedition's photographer. Custer is pictured with the scout Bloody Knife, engineer William Ludlow, and Private Noonan. Likely Illingworth's most well-known work, the photo was often reproduced and widely sold as a stereograph.
